Releases af Unilogins BPI webservices
Releasenr. | Releasedato | Beskrivelse | Nyt versionsnr. i webservice | ||||
R1.30 | 26, august 2019 | Vedligehold og mindre fejlrettelser | Nej | ||||
R1.31 | 23. januar 2020 | Håndtering af modtagelse af tomme Alias navne | Nej | ||||
R1.32 | februar 2020 | Ny rolle fra rollekataloget: Officiel tilknyttet person | Ja | ||||
R1.33 |
| Vedligehold | Nej | ||||
R1.34 | 10. August 2020 | Vedligehold | Nej | ||||
R1.35 | 11. september 2020 | Låsning af importer på institutioner | Nej | ||||
R1.36 | 21. oktober 2020 | Omidentifikation | Nej | ||||
37 | juli 2021 | Større teknologisk omlægning som giver anledning til et tvunget versionsskifte af flere af STIL's webservices. Derudover indeholder releasen også rettelser, som på sigt skal gøre det muligt at understøtte oprettelse | R1.37 | TBA | Understøttelseaf flere end 10 kontaktpersoner for børn på bosteder. | Ny version af wsiEKSPORT.Ja | |
R1.38 | TBA | Understøttelse af flere end 10 kontaktpersoner for børn på bosteder. Ny version af wsaIMPORT. | Ja |
...
STIL anbefaler, at anvende den nyeste version af BPI-webservices, fordi opdateringerne kan indeholde vigtige og nødvendige fejlrettelser og ændringer.
Uddybende beskrivelse af udvalgte releases
Release Releasenote ws-r1.37
Releasen indeholder en større teknologisk omlægning. Ændringerne giver anledning til et tvunget versionsskifte af de fire webservices
- wsiBRUGER
- wsiINST
- wsiIDENTIFIKATION
- wsiEKSPORT
Fra juli 2021 kan leverandørerne begynde at skifte til de nye versioner af de fire webservices. Skiftet skal være gennemført senest 21 november 2021, hvorefter alle tidligere versioner af de fire webservices lukkes.
Se også oversigten over aktuelle driftsversioner af webservices Oversigt over versioner af BPI-webservices
Udover den teknologiske omlægning indeholder releasen den første del af den rettelse, der er nødvendig for at kunne understøtte For at understøtte at børn på bosteder kan have mere end 10 officielt tilknyttede kontakt personer er det nødvendigt, at lave en opdatering af skemaet i wsiEKSPORT. Der er altså tale om en ny version af wsiEKSPORT, som alle leverandører skal skifte til.kontaktpersoner samt en justering af xml-schemaet for at klargøre webservicen til en fremtidig release ift understøttelse af erhvervsidentiteter.
Understøttelse af flere end 10 kontakt personer.
Denne ændring kræver, at alle leverandører først skifter til den nye version af wsiEKSPORT og dernæst skifter til den kommende version af wsaIMPORT, som kommer med release R1.38
I denne release er skemaet i wsiEKSPORT blevet opdateret, så det understøtter at et barn kan have flere end 10 kontaktpersoner. Ændringen Ændringen er markeret med rødt i tabellen nedenfor.
...
Felt | Type | Antal | Beskrivelse |
Role | Enum | 1 | Elevens Rolle: "Barn" for barn i dagtilbud. "Elev" for alle der går i skole eller "Studerende". |
StudentNumber | String | 0-1 | Elevens studienummer fra lokalt administrativt system. |
Level | Enum | 1 | Elevens trin. En af følgende værdier: DT, 0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, U1, U2, U3, U4, VU, Andet. DT er dagtilbud, 1 svarer til 1. klassetrin i grundskolen, U1 er første trin på en ungdomsuddannelse. VU er voksenuddannelse. |
Location | String | 0-1 | Afdeling, bygning eller værelsesnummer på efterskoler. |
MainGroupId | String | 1 | Elevens hovedgruppe. For grundskoler elevens klasse og kan for andre institutioner for eksempel studieretning eller stamhold. (groupType for mainGroup er ”Hovedgruppe”) |
GroupId | String | 0-n | Yderligere grupper eleven er tilknyttet, ud over tilknytningen via MainGroupId. |
ContactPerson | Contact-Person | Ændres fra 0-10 til 0-n | Kontaktperson |
Klargøring til understøttelse af erhvervsidentiteter for en kontakt person
Ændringen er markeret med rødt i tabellen nedenfor.
ContactPerson
Felt | Type | Antal | Beskrivelse |
relation | Enum | 1 | Kontaktpersonens relation til eleven. |
childCustody | Bool | 1 | Har personen forældremyndighed? |
TBA | TBA | TBA | TBA |
accessLevel (F) | Enum | 1 | 0 (default) angiver at kontaktpersonen må få adgang til almindelige personoplysninger om den tilknyttede elev. 1 angiver at kontaktpersonen må få adgang til fortrolige og følsomme personoplysninger om eleven. NB. Hvis kontaktpersonen ikke er forældremyndighedsindehaver, skal hjemmel opnås på anden vis. |
Person | Person | 1 | Personoplysninger på kontaktpersonen |
UNILogin | UNILogin | 0-1 | Eventuelle Unilogin-oplysninger |
...
Dokumentation af tidligere releases
Udvid | ||||||||||||||||||||||||||||||||||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| ||||||||||||||||||||||||||||||||||||||||||||||||||||
Releases af Unilogins BPI webservices
STIL anbefaler, at anvende den nyeste version af BPI-webservices, fordi opdateringerne kan indeholde vigtige og nødvendige fejlrettelser og ændringer. Uddybende beskrivelse af udvalgte releases Release ws-r1.36 Indeholder de nødvendige rettelser, der skal til for at få omidentifikation til at virke igen. Release ws-r1.35 Der indføres en låsning på importerne, således at en institution kun kan have en aktiv import ad gangen. Hvis en institution har en aktiv import og der sendes en ny import imens den første import behandles vil den sidste import blive afvist med fejlbesked: Fejl 10: Importen er låst, den bliver låst op dd.MM.yyyy HH:mm.ss. Bruger:wsbrugerid Institution:NNNNNN Kilde:kilde Release ws-r1.34 Releasen indeholder ingen ændringer. Release ws-r1.33 Releasen indeholder ingen ændringer. Release ws-r1.32 Med release ws-r1.32 indføres der en ny rolle fra rollekataloget. Rollen er "Officiel tilknyttet person" i tabellen ContactPerson: ContactPerson
Link til Rollekataloget https://www.kl.dk/media/11557/rollekatalog-for-bpi-brugeraktrer-og-brugerroller.pdf |